About the Role

Harrogate College are recruiting for a Course Leader in Electrical Installation to join the team.

The Ideal candidate would be a qualified Electrical Installer and have a Teaching qualification, A1 and V1 or a desire to achieve these. Experience of delivering City & Guilds qualifications would be an advantage.

If you have the relevant industry experience and want to get into teaching as a career, we will support you with your teacher training as part of the package.

We are a growing Engineering department, based in Harrogate. We are passionate about sustainability and Green Sector Skills and as part of this are developing a curriculum to meet the needs of industry and local employers. We deliver to 16-18, 19+ on part time and full time basis and apprentices. We offer pathways in Automotive, Construction and Electrical Installation.

The department is dynamic and has a range of staff straight from industry along with those that have experience of the education sector. All bring knowledge and experience to the table and are enthusiastic to share with the learners. 

What You Will Do

  • The successful candidate will be responsible for the development, planning and delivery of the curriculum to learners at Level 1-3 and CPD courses.
  • Lead, inspire and support learners with different abilities and learning styles.
  • Interview and complete initial assessments of the learners’ skills within the subject.
  • Deliver and assess work, giving regular appropriate developmental feedback and maintain records of learners’ progress and development.
  • Identify and plan additional support and interventions for learners as necessary.
  • Act as company representatives at parents’ evenings, taster days and open days.
  • Manage learner behaviour and apply appropriate and effective measures in line with College policies.
  • Ensure that safeguarding, prevent and equality and diversity policies are always followed, and concerns are reported accordingly.
  • Keep up to date with all mandatory training and ensure it is logged appropriately
  • Contribute to the Department Self Assessment Report.

About Us

Harrogate College has excellent facilities and provides a professional and friendly environment. We pride ourselves on working closely with employers, the local community and other stakeholders to provide curriculum and support that meets the needs of our students. We are working towards becoming a recognised centre of green excellence which is supported through our sustainability pledge to become a net zero college by 2035. 

We have recently been awarded £16m of government funding to transform our campus. The energy-efficient new building will include a workshop unit that provides large scale facilities aligned to industry needs including advanced manufacturing, low carbon construction, retrofit, sustainable energy and bio-economy, health science and hospitality. This will complement the college’s existing tech centre which is home to its motor vehicle, electrical, joinery and welding workshops.
